Double barrel shotguns were used quite extensively by the Russian forces during world war 2 as many many civilians owned them (don't have to worry about arming them), both the guns and the shells were quite easy to produce and maintain, and they were quite effective in trench and house warfare despite the fact that they were quite tedious to handle.
